Explaining the Science Behind Lanolin Concrete Release Agents
Lanolin concrete release agents are commonly used in construction to avoid concrete from sticking to mold. This effect is primarily due to the hydrophobic characteristics of lanolin, a natural wax derived from sheep's wool. The molecular arrangement of lanolin allows it to create a coating between the concrete and the construction surface, permitting easy disengagement once the concrete has hardened.
Furthermore, lanolin's smoothness minimizes friction between the concrete and the formwork, improving the quality of the finished concrete. This results in a neater surface finish and prevents the risk of defects to the concrete.
The performance of lanolin concrete release agents is assigned to its ability to adhere to both the formwork and the wet concrete, forming a stable release membrane. Nevertheless, suitable application methods are essential to maximize the performance of lanolin release agents.
